About PMIC - Supervisors


PMIC supervisors are integrated circuits that monitor system voltages, currents, and temperatures to ensure proper functioning and safety of electronic systems. They provide functions such as voltage monitoring, reset generation, and power-on sequencing to guarantee stable operation and prevent system malfunctions or damage due to voltage fluctuations or power failures.
